Job description

SUMMARY: The Maintenance Technician's primary responsibility is to ensure that equipment is safely operating and meets its intended use optimizing equipment up-time. The purpose of the Maintenance employee is to make scheduled and unscheduled repairs on all machines and related equipment used in manufacturing. Reports administratively to the Maintenance Supervisor.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ES include the following.
  • Ensure preventative / predictive maintenance on equipment, machinery, tools and document PM through the Maintenance Supervisor.
  • Review and inspect equipment on a daily basis for safe and proper operating conditions.
  • Assist with major job repairs to machine, equipment or components and troubleshooting when needed.
  • Submit requests to Maintenance Supervisor for proper approval and authorization for machine replacement parts, equipment or components.
  • Change oil on equipment as recommended by manufacturer.
  • Follow all safety precautions on repairs to equipment, machinery and tools per MPI's / OSHA requirements.
  • Responsibilities include all listed above, but are not limited to only those listed above.
  • Complete any and all tasks or assignments as requested by Management
  • Maintain compliance of IATF 16949 / ISO 9001 / ISO 14001.

Follows all safety, housekeeping and company policies and procedures.
Coordinates and maintains all job responsibilities in a continuous and flexible manner and performs other related duties and job assignments as required.
QUALIFICATIONS To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
EDUCATION and/or EXPERIENCE BS in Electrical Engineering or equivalent experience. 3-5 years maintenance experience in plastic injection molding manufacturing environment. Proficient in troubleshooting and repairing electrical, hydraulic, mechanical, programmable controller problems. Experience in operating various machining equipment.
PHYSICAL DEMANDS The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to sit, stand, talk, hear, and walk. Frequently climb, bend, squat, reach, twist/turn and lift up to 50 lbs. Specific vision abilities required by this job include ability to adjust focus.
